Knitted gifts for visitors to Leeds' Breast Cancer Haven Yorkshire

Visitors to Breast Cancer Haven Yorkshire in Leeds have been receiving knitted gifts, thanks to generous crafters from across the country.

Members of the craft community LoveKnitting supported Breast Cancer Haven’s annual Big Tea Cosy campaign by selling exclusive knitting and crochet patterns - with many customers who bought the patterns choosing to gift their finished woollen creations to someone going through breast cancer treatment as a sign of support.

With a choice of hats, blankets, hot water bottle covers and many more, the limited edition patterns were all specifically designed to provide comfort to those people going through breast cancer treatment. More than 60 individual knitted items were donated to Breast Cancer Haven centres across the country.

Breast Cancer Haven Yorkshire visitor Janet Drury, who received one of the knitted hot water bottles said: “I was delighted to receive such a lovely gift, made even more special because it was created in loving generosity to support Breast Cancer Haven visitors like me. I look forward to using it over the frosty winter months.”

Breast Cancer Haven is now inviting crafters to take part in next year’s Big Tea Cosy campaign in March 2019.
